About the Company:
Kā te Rama is a newly established, Māori-owned infrastructure services group, owned by Ngāti Toa Rangatira. While the enterprise is new, the businesses behind it are not, this is not a start-up: PAE and Switched On bring more than 70 years of combined operating experience, established national operations and long-standing customer relationships. This is a rare opportunity to take what is strongest in each of these businesses and deliberately build a new enterprise from that foundation.
Culture:
Kā te Rama is commercially focused, and performance matters. At the same time, Ngāti Toa ownership shapes how the organisation thinks about leadership, relationships and stewardship. The emerging Kā te Rama Way draws on kaitiakitanga, manaakitanga, whanaungatanga and rangatiratanga, principles applied practically rather than symbolically: looking after what has been entrusted, building enduring relationships, and taking accountability for outcomes. You don't need to be an expert in te ao Māori to join, but curiosity, respect and a genuine willingness to learn are expected.
